Why not put the code just in the LostFocus ot Valid events of the individual controls?

>I have a form that users must mandatory entries into textboxes
>before they exit the screen and move on to another screen.
>
>For example:
>
>If empty(act_plan.startdate)
>=messagebox("You must enter a Startdate for your Intervention!", 48, "CATS")
> this.parent.text1.setfocus()
>Endif
>
>I have this code in the save button and if nothing entered it sets focus to that field until something is entered. I also have this code in the exit button on the form. If they inadvertly hit the exit button I get the message, it doesn't set focus to the textbox
>and continues on and releases the form.
>
>How can I ensure that they fill this textbox and not exit the screen
>screen? Does this code belong in the "valid" of the textbox as well?
>Any input would be appreciated.
>Thanks.
